Clinical Trial Title

Inflammatory bowel repository



Clinical Trial Protocol Description

The Section of Gastroenterology & Nutrition at Rush University Medical Center in Chicago maintains a tissue storage bank that allows us to collect small biopsies (tissue) samples from persons undergoing endoscopic procedures.  Such procedures may include colonoscopy, endoscopy and EGD. This tissue storage bank allows researchers to run experiments on tissue samples of both healthy individuals and those who are afflicted with gastrointestinal conditions to determine the cause of such disorders and develop more effective therapeutic treatments.



Clinical Trial Eligibility Criteria

To participate in this study, you must:

  • Be over age 18
  • Be able to give consent
  • Be undergoing a clinically indicated (physician prescribed) endoscopic procedure
